If you are new to the world of online slots, RTP can be confusing. It stands for “Return to Player” and indicates the expected percentage of the amount of money a slot machine will pay back to players over a large number of spins. A slot’s RTP is based on the overall average of the percentages of the total bet that are returned to players over multiple million bets.
